Jesse P. Gilmore discusses the importance of having an exponentially growing pipeline for your business. He points out that relying on only one of the three main client attraction systems, such as referrals, network, or cold emails, can lead to limited growth and uncertainty in your business. Instead, he suggests integrating all three systems to create an exponentially growing pipeline. Jesse provides examples of how this approach has helped his clients, such as Susan, achieve massive growth in their businesses. In the daily leverage segment, he challenges listeners to identify where they may be focusing solely on one client attraction system and encourages them to optimize all three for an exponentially growing pipeline.

Let’s solve that today by talking about when your pipeline is relying on one of three main systems. 

 

So the problem is that a lot of times, agency owners will focus on things like referrals or their network or maybe just cold email. And when something doesn’t work, when it comes to bringing on new clients, they basically kind of doubled down on what had worked in the past. But ultimately, your network is only so big and there’s only so many people that are on your list. And there needs to be a reliance upon kind of like an integration between your client attraction systems. This is ultimately one of the things that we talk a lot about in our monthly events where people need to create an exponentially growing pipeline based around all the things that we talked about in the previous episodes, based around the main obstacles holding you back, which was obstacle number one, freeing up the time. Obstacle number two is based around getting everything out of your head. Number three was based around an offer that’s both scalable and profitable. And once you have those three, kind of the dominoes are being set, then the most important thing is actually to grow a pipeline exponentially, utilizing all three of the client traction systems. You have outbound, inbound, and referral systems. And so the problem is that when you are only relying on either one of these systems or even just one channel within these systems, you ultimately don’t really have control of growth. You might be able to retain clients, which is ultimately something that allows you to grow. but you don’t really have control of clients coming in. 

 

What this leads towards is an uncertainty within your business to be able to see a vision of massive growth. And it also leads towards incremental growth as opposed to exponential growth. Incremental growth for an entrepreneur, an actual entrepreneur who focuses on expansion all the time, is basically death. When you’re only growing at 20% year over year, It’s really a boring business and it leads towards at times wanting to burn it all to the ground.
